利用redisReader->rstack堆栈解析响应,将命令的响应以redisReply的形式返回给客户端。 hiredis一次尽可能多的读取来自服务器端的响应,但一次却只返回一个响应。客户端可以使用类似管道的机制,将多个命令一次发给服务器,然后可以按照 添加命令的顺序获取对应的响应。 客户端使用完响应后,释放redisReply资源。 在解析该串...
lpush+lpop=Stack(栈) lpush+rpop=Queue(队列) lpush+ltrim=Capped Collection(有限集合) lpush+brpop=Message Queue(消息队列) 操作命令 Lpush——先进后出,在列表头部插入元素 Rpush——先进先出,在列表的尾部插入元素 Lrange——出栈,根据索引,获取列表元素 Lpop——左边出栈,获取列表的第一个元素 Rpop——右边...